Job Summary and Responsibilities The Telecommunication Equipment Installer II is responsible for the installation and maintenance of telecommunication equipment for a variety of carriers. This includes fiber, transport equipment and all critical infrastructures within a central office. This role will provide high-quality service in customer technical spaces including data centers, mobile telephone switch centers, central office wire centers, and designated enterprise spaces. - Physically place, remove, or modify non-working equipment including the following:
- Install superstructure components in support of cabling systems such as auxiliary bars, threaded rods, cable racking, cable trays, wire basket systems, etc...
- Cutting, filing, drilling, modifying infrastructure components and working with various tools such as bandsaw, hammer drill, jigsaw, ratchet/sockets, etc...
- Installation of data equipment cabinets and frames, data servers, switches, routers, repeaters, bridges, gateways, multiplexers, transceivers, firewalls.
- Identify, label, measure, terminate and physically route the cables that supply AC and/or DC power or transmit data in various technical spaces.
- Identify, label, measure, terminate and physically route fiber optic and copper cables for high-speed data transmission, ensuring precise cable management and minimal signal loss.
- Resolve equipment and technical issues as they arise.
- Read, analyze, and interpret detailed specifications and drawings, blueprints, schematics, and method of procedures (MOPs).
- Perform quality validation on in-process and completed work.
- Complete operations paperwork (e.g., expense reports, timesheets, job documentation, etc.) including daily job status reports as requested.
- Work independently to complete tasks per direction of lead installer.
- Perform basic cable testing; fiber & copper continuity, etc...
- Act as a customer contact; interface with customers and local supervisors regarding project status.
- Interact with all members of the organization including Installation, Engineering, Project Management.
- Perform other duties as requested.

- High school diploma or equivalent required, technical or college degree preferred.
- Two years of central office equipment installation experience preferred.
- Clear understanding of AT&T, Telcordia, and/or Verizon Quality Standards
- Basic knowledge and experience with transport equipment including Ciena, Fujitsu, Cisco, Calix, Adtran, Nortel, Nokia, etc.
- Background in fiber optic cable and AC/DC power installation and testing practices
- Proficient use of Microsoft programs, IOS and/or Android applications
- Ability to read and understand technical drawings and documentation.
- Good mechanical aptitude including usage of basic power tools.
